Edwards Lifesciences is seeking a Sr. Principal NPD Engineer to lead the transition of advanced, sensor-integrated medical devices from design into Commercial production. This role is a key leadership position within our New Product Development (NPD) team, responsible for developing the manufacturing processes, test systems, and production specifications that ensure our electronic medical devices meet global safety and performance standards from Day one. The Sr. Principal Engineer will act as the lead manufacturing voice in R&D design reviews, ensuring that sensor architectures and electronic assemblies are optimized for cost-effective, high-yield production. They will develop and implement end-of-line production testing for safety and functionality, including Hipot & Leakage Current Testing and EMC Assurance. The role involves developing detailed manufacturing specifications & Instructions, Bill of Materials (BOM), and assembly drawings, and partnering with R&D to define critical-to-quality (CTQ) dimensions and tolerances for sensors and electronics. Additionally, the Sr. Principal Engineer will lead the strategy and execution of Installation, Operational, and Performance Qualifications for new assembly lines and automated sensor calibration equipment, interface with external electronic manufacturing services (EMS) and sensor suppliers, and author and maintain Process Failure Mode and Effects Analysis (PFMEA). This position owns the device system end-to-end of new product development, thinking strategically about new product development, leading strategy, prioritization, and technical support for QST, pre DV, DV – SME to Pilot on root cause investigations for manufacturing processes (prior to commercialization). They will also serve as team lead in the analysis of basic Manufacturing and Compliance issues and provide technical support in process transfer, identify opportunities for redesign/design of basic equipment, tools, fixtures, etc., and support commercial redesign opportunities and notifications of change from suppliers. The role involves improving manufacturing processes using engineering methods for continuous process improvement and supporting stability metrics through design phases, following project plans to ensure deliverables are completed to customer expectations, and overseeing manufacturing support tasks, supervising technicians and/or lower-level engineers.
